Abstract

Plastics molding is a manufacturing process in which plastic material is melted and injected into a mold, also known as plastic injection manufacturing, to obtain the desired shape. It is one of the main techniques in the manufacturing of various plastic products in various industries, such as toys, car parts, home appliances, medical products, and others. In the plastic molding process, there are many parameters that must be considered to produce a perfect product and no defects such as shrinkage, uneven color, cracks, and blemishes.
One of the main aspects that often causes product reject rates is temperature change. Where each material of the product to be produced has a different temperature level in processing it, the process of designing an improvement strategy in the plastic molding process should focus more on the temperature factor as the main part. The improvements designed must be appropriate and consider the temperature variability that can affect product quality.
